That issue resulted in route stacking and some students arriving late to school, CPS explained. WARREN, Mich. (AP) A boy grabbed the steering wheel on a school bus and hit the brakes, bringing the vehicle to a safe stop on a busy Detroit-area road after the driver had passed out, authorities said.
